Output 9764c9405adc680ee0f551a73c527fe1594b3731f92cdf93c4310011b272c3e6:27

value
416486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856cb630c42ea15dac7e048e3fc38848f6884a8a OP_EQUAL
address
3DrW2UdkY6VXhKub1sJ23bf1DfyjqVETQM
transaction
9764c9405adc680ee0f551a73c527fe1594b3731f92cdf93c4310011b272c3e6
confirmations
265434
spent
true